JACOBSON v. HARRIS

No. 4-70 Civ. 241.

313 F.Supp. 1036 (1970)

Maynard Allen JACOBSON, 13460-148, Petitioner, v. C. E. HARRIS, Warden, U. S. Penitentiary, Marion, Illinois, United States Board of Parole, and Donald W. Kostohryz, Chief United States Probation Officer, Respondents.

United States District Court, D. Minnesota, Third Division.

June 15, 1970.


ORDER

DEVITT, Chief Judge.

Petitioner, an inmate of the Federal Penitentiary at Marion, Illinois, is seeking release from confinement. He claims he was denied procedural rights under rules promulgated by the United States Board of Parole. He states he was denied a parole revocation hearing.
